3(x-5)+1=2+1x
We move all terms to the left:
3(x-5)+1-(2+1x)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
3(x-5)-(x+2)+1=0
We multiply parentheses
3x-(x+2)-15+1=0
We get rid of parentheses
3x-x-2-15+1=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
2x-16=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
2x=16
x=16/2
x=8
